基于单片机的数字式频率检测装置设计.doc
![preview](https://dl-preview.csdnimg.cn/88027484/0001-163fe09e21e935b6eadc52f1b1a16be4_thumbnail-wide.jpeg)
![preview-icon](https://csdnimg.cn/release/downloadcmsfe/public/img/scale.ab9e0183.png)
【基于单片机的数字式频率检测装置设计】 在现代电子技术中,频率测量是至关重要的一个环节。本文主要探讨了一种基于AT89S52单片机的数字频率计设计,它能够准确地测量并显示信号的频率。这种频率计通过优化硬件资源和巧妙的软件设计,实现了高效且精确的频率检测。 1. 系统概述 数字频率计是一种用于测量周期性电信号频率的电子设备。AT89S52单片机作为核心部件,具备丰富的I/O端口和内部定时器功能,适合作为频率计的控制中心。设计思路是首先对输入的被测信号进行放大整形,确保其兼容单片机的输入标准,然后利用内部定时器固定时间间隔来计算单位时间内接收到的脉冲数量,从而得到频率值。最后,通过LCD液晶显示屏显示测量结果。 1.1 数字频率计概述 数字频率计采用数字电路进行频率测量,具有高精度、快速响应和直观显示的优点。AT89S52单片机是8位微控制器,拥有8K的EPROM存储空间,32个可编程I/O口线,两个16位定时器/计数器,以及串行通信接口,适合于实现复杂的控制任务。 1.2 频率测量仪的设计思路与计算 设计思路包括信号调理、频率计算和数据显示三部分。首先,被测信号经过放大整形,转换为TTL/CMOS兼容的方波信号,进入单片机的T1输入口。单片机内部定时器设置为1秒定时,记录在此期间接收到的脉冲数,脉冲数即为频率的倒数。频率计算公式为:频率 = 1 / (脉冲数 / 定时时间)。 1.3 基本设计原理 利用单片机的定时器功能,配合输入信号的脉冲计数,可以实现频率的精确测量。T1作为计数器,每接收一个脉冲就增加一次计数值,当达到一定时间(如1秒)后,停止计数,读取当前值作为频率测量结果。 2. 数字频率计的硬件结构设计 2.1 系统硬件构成 系统主要由以下几个部分组成:单片机、信号调理及放大整形模块、LCD显示模块以及电源和控制电路。 2.2 AT89S52单片机及其引脚说明 AT89S52单片机拥有20个引脚,分别用于电源、接地、复位、晶振、I/O口、定时器/计数器、串行通信等,通过编程实现系统的控制和数据处理。 2.3 信号调理及放大整形模块 此模块的作用是将输入信号转换为单片机能识别的电平。LF353双运算放大器被用来放大信号并将其转换为方波,以确保单片机的T1输入口能够准确捕获。 2.4 显示模块 1602A LCD模块用于显示测量结果,通过单片机的I/O口与之通信,显示频率值。 3. 软件设计 3.1 系统工作流程 软件设计主要包括定时器T0用于1秒定时,T1作为计数器进行脉冲计数。当T0溢出时,读取T1的计数值,计算频率,并更新LCD显示。 3.1.1 T0的1s定时 通过设置T0的工作模式,使其在1秒后产生中断,触发频率计算。 3.1.2 T1的计数原理 T1工作在计数模式下,每当接收到一个脉冲,计数值增加1。 3.2 软件工作原理 软件通过循环执行任务,监控T0和T1的状态,实时更新频率值并发送到LCD显示。 3.3 软件处理方法 软件处理包括中断服务程序和主循环程序,中断服务程序处理T0溢出事件,主循环程序负责更新显示和系统其他功能。 4. 实验结果与分析 实际操作中,该设计能够准确测量并显示低频信号的频率,表现出良好的稳定性和精度。然而,由于篇幅限制,具体的实验结果和分析未在摘要中详述。 总结,基于单片机的数字频率计设计充分展示了单片机在电子测量中的应用潜力,通过合理利用硬件资源和精心设计的软件,实现了高效、精确的频率测量。这种设计不仅适用于实验室环境,还可在各种工业和科研领域中发挥作用。
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![](https://csdnimg.cn/release/download_crawler_static/88027484/bg1.jpg)
![](https://csdnimg.cn/release/download_crawler_static/88027484/bg2.jpg)
![](https://csdnimg.cn/release/download_crawler_static/88027484/bg3.jpg)
剩余19页未读,继续阅读
![avatar-default](https://csdnimg.cn/release/downloadcmsfe/public/img/lazyLogo2.1882d7f4.png)
![avatar](https://profile-avatar.csdnimg.cn/acfce43ffe2c41f996326bd927946824_yhsbzl.jpg!1)
- 粉丝: 3719
- 资源: 59万+
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助
![voice](https://csdnimg.cn/release/downloadcmsfe/public/img/voice.245cc511.png)
![center-task](https://csdnimg.cn/release/downloadcmsfe/public/img/center-task.c2eda91a.png)
![dialog-icon](https://csdnimg.cn/release/downloadcmsfe/public/img/green-success.6a4acb44.png)